These men and women driving the scenes structure, Make, and sustain the computer software that powers our digital life. As additional enterprises and industries trust in technology, the demand from customers for software package motor
So, what for anyone who is enthusiastic about the tech industry but not considering coding? Don’t be concerned—there are several IT Employment without the need of coding that let you wor
In 2004 it had been demonstrated that MD5 is just not collision-resistant.[27] Therefore, MD5 is not really well suited for purposes like SSL certificates or electronic signatures that rely on this property for digital security. Researchers In addition found far more major flaws in MD5, and described a feasible collision attack—a way to make a set of inputs for which MD5 makes equivalent checksums.
In case you enter another few of numbers from our checklist, you are going to observe the hashing Device managing the hashing Procedure in the same way as over:
In 1993, Den Boer and Bosselaers gave an early, Though limited, result of locating a "pseudo-collision" of the MD5 compression purpose; that may be, two diverse initialization vectors that deliver An analogous digest.
MD5 utilizes the Merkle–Damgård design, Therefore if two prefixes With all the exact hash is usually manufactured, a common suffix is usually extra to both equally for making the collision much more prone to be accepted as legitimate facts by the appliance applying it. Additionally, present collision-acquiring strategies permit specifying an arbitrary prefix: an attacker can create two colliding documents that each start with exactly the same written content.
Great importance MD5, an abbreviation for Information-Digest Algorithm five, is actually a widely applied cryptographic hash operate that performs a crucial position in ensuring info protection and integrity.
The MD5 algorithm is a cryptographic hash purpose that generates a 128-bit hash value from enter get more info details. Though it absolutely was at first employed for facts integrity verification and password hashing, it is currently regarded insecure because of collision vulnerabilities.
Insecure hash functions Preferably render this activity computationally unachievable. However, MD5’s flaws authorized these types of assaults with considerably less perform than necessary.
S. and/or other countries. See Logos for ideal markings. Some other trademarks contained herein would be the assets in their respective proprietors.
MD5 is also Employed in the field of electronic discovery, to provide a unique identifier for each document which is exchanged over the lawful discovery system.
Limitations in Hash Duration: MD5 generates a set hash value of 128 bits. Although this may possibly appear to be a ample standard of safety, advances in computational ability have rendered it obsolete.
In advance of diving into MD5 precisely, let us briefly contact upon the idea of hashing normally. In basic phrases, hashing is often a system that usually takes an input (also known as the message or information) and creates a fixed-dimension string of figures as output, which can be called the hash code or hash price.
On the list of main weaknesses of MD5 is its vulnerability to collision assaults. In simple terms, a collision occurs when two different inputs produce the same hash output. That's like two different people having the same fingerprint—shouldn't materialize, ideal?